Event Objectives

By the end of the training, participants will be able to:  

• Explain the basic principles of the 2030 Agenda and the Sustainable Development Goals.   

• Identify key environmental challenges related to the “Planet” dimension of the 2030 Agenda.  

• Recognize the role of individuals, educational communities and local organizations in protecting ecosystems and biodiversity. 

• Apply the knowledge acquired through participatory practical activities. 

• Identify opportunities for developing community-based Nature-Based Solutions in their local environment.

Background

Cascos Verdes is an environmental education and citizen participation initiative promoted by CIFAL Malaga, inspired by the United Nations Blue Helmets. The initiative seeks to engage citizens and organizations in protecting local ecosystems and contributing to environmental sustainability through education and tangible action.  Within the implementation of Cascos Verdes in the Axarquía region, the educational component aims to raise environmental awareness among students and teachers and encourage the transition from theoretical learning to practical action. The training introduces participants to the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development, with particular emphasis on the “Planet” dimension, and provides a foundation for the subsequent development of community-based Nature-Based Solutions.

 

Content and Structure

The training programme has a total duration of 8 hours and combines theoretical learning with practical and participatory activities. It consists of: 

 • An introductory theoretical component on the 2030 Agenda and the Sustainable Development Goals. 

• Five practical and participatory workshops focused particularly on the “Planet” dimension of the 2030 Agenda. 

• A group assessment to consolidate and evaluate the knowledge acquired during the training. 

 Completion of the training provides the educational foundation for participating schools to subsequently develop and submit community-based Nature-Based Solutions within the Cascos Verdes project.

Methodology

The training follows an active, participatory and practice-oriented methodology. Teachers from the selected schools will register on the Cascos Verdes portal and receive access to credentials for their classes. The training will be undertaken collectively in the classroom, combining theoretical content with five practical workshops designed to encourage participation, reflection and the application of sustainability concepts.  Participants will complete a group assessment after completing the training modules. Students and teachers who successfully complete the programme will be eligible to receive a certificate of completion issued by CIFAL Malaga and UNITAR. Completion of the training and assessment is also a prerequisite for participating in schools wishing to submit a microproject during the subsequent phase of the Cascos Verdes initiative.

Targeted Audience

Students aged 11 to 18 and teachers from selected educational institutions in the Axarquía region, Málaga, Spain.
